I firstly read the pdf of the book and after completing it i just knew- I have to buy my own copy, so I can hold onto it forever.❤️
It Ends With Us is a huge emotional rollercoaster. It made me laugh, it made me cry and sometimes both at once. Like legit BIG, FAT TEARS.
I thought that it was like any other cheesy romance novel but i was totally wrong. It Ends With Us is phenomenal! It makes you fall in love, breaks your heart and forces you to reconsider your prejudged ideas about domestic abuse and violence.

(spoilers)
I absolutely loved Ryle. (Initially obv) The very first scene in the book, on the roof.. it was my absolute favourite.
The more I got into the story- the more his character grew on me until.. the incident occurred. I mean obv a toxic relationship is a straight up NO.
I mean I've never felt this conflicted over a character before. 
My most fav character in the book was Atlas. His story gutted me at times. I initially didn't want his entry coz i was already in love with Ryle so he felt like a threat but.. what he and Lily had was so real and i was blown away by his commitment. Lily was a really strong character throughout the book and I loved her.

The part I didn't like was- the diary entries addressed to Ellen DeGeneres, coz they just felt so cringe & honestly I wanted to skip those.
